Airbnb Seasonality Analysis & Trends in Blairgowrie and Rattray (2025)

Peak Season (August, July, June)
  • Revenue averages $4,009 per month
  • Occupancy rates average 57.3%
  • Daily rates average $252
Shoulder Season
  • Revenue averages $3,045 per month
  • Occupancy maintains around 45.4%
  • Daily rates hold near $242
Low Season (January, February, November)
  • Revenue drops to average $2,230 per month
  • Occupancy decreases to average 34.0%
  • Daily rates adjust to average $239

Seasonality Insights for Blairgowrie and Rattray

  • The Airbnb seasonality in Blairgowrie and Rattray shows highly seasonal trends requiring careful strategy. While the sections above show seasonal averages, it's also insightful to look at the extremes:
  • During the high season, the absolute peak month showcases Blairgowrie and Rattray's highest earning potential, with monthly revenues capable of climbing to $4,598, occupancy reaching a high of 69.6%, and ADRs peaking at $253.
  • Conversely, the slowest single month of the year, typically falling within the low season, marks the market's lowest point. In this month, revenue might dip to $2,123, occupancy could drop to 31.1%, and ADRs may adjust down to $231.

Blairgowrie and Rattray STR Booking Lead Time Analysis (2025)

Average Booking Lead Time by Month

Booking Lead Time Insights for Blairgowrie and Rattray

  • The overall average booking lead time for vacation rentals in Blairgowrie and Rattray is 66 days.
  • Guests book furthest in advance for stays during June (average 100 days), likely coinciding with peak travel demand or local events.
  • The shortest booking windows occur for stays in February (average 52 days), indicating more last-minute travel plans during this time.
  • Seasonally, Summer (81 days avg.) sees the longest lead times, while Winter (60 days avg.) has the shortest, reflecting typical travel planning cycles.
